Martino La Farina (died 17 September 1668) was a Roman Catholic bishop who served as Prelate of Santa Lucia del Mela (1648–1668).[1]
Biography
On 21 September 1648, Martino La Farina was appointed by Pope Innocent X as Bishop of the Territorial Prelature of Santa Lucia del Mela.[1] He served as Prelate of Santa Lucia del Mela until his death on 17 September 1668.[1]
